Grill

Using the griddle 1, you can simultaneously grill
meat, fi sh or vegetables to accompany the raclette.

NOTE

The griddle 1 takes about 10 minutes to
heat up. Only then can you cook food on
the griddle 1!

1) Lightly oil the top of the griddle 1.
2) Place the food to be grilled onto the griddle 1

and turn it occasionally as required.

ATTENTION! DAMAGE TO PROPERTY!

Do not use metal implements such as knives,
forks, etc. Should the non-stick coating be-
come damaged, stop using the appliance.

Cleaning and care

DANGER – ELECTRIC SHOCK!

Before cleaning the appliance, disconnect
the plug from the mains power socket!
Risk of electric shock!

NEVER immerse the appliance in water or

other liquids!

WARNING! RISK OF INJURY!

Always allow the appliance to cool down
before cleaning it. Otherwise there is a risk
of burns!

It is best to clean the appliance as soon as it has
cooled down. This makes food residue easier to
remove.

ATTENTION! DAMAGE TO PROPERTY!

Do not use abrasive or aggressive cleaning
materials. These could damage the surface
of the appliance!

Do not clean the components of the appli-
ance in a dishwasher!

Clean the appliance housing and the heating
coil 3 with a damp cloth. If necessary, put a
little mild detergent on the cloth and wipe this
off afterwards with fresh water. Dry everything
properly.

Clean the griddle 1, the wooden spatula 5
and the pans 4 in warm soapy water. Dry all
parts properly after cleaning.

Storage

Store the cleaned appliance in a clean, dust-free
and dry location.
